Case Study: A Tricky Diagnosis
A customer brought in an ’08 Trailblazer with a frustrating problem: it would occasionally refuse to shift out of 2nd gear, but only after driving for 20+ minutes. There were no consistent codes, just a general P0700 (Transmission Control System Malfunction) that would pop up intermittently. We checked the fluid, solenoids, and wiring harness—all looked fine. From experience, I know that heat-soak can cause hairline cracks in the TCM’s circuit board to expand, creating these ghost-like electrical issues. We swapped in one of our VIN-programmed T42 modules, and the problem vanished instantly. The customer saved hundreds compared to a dealership diagnosis that might have needlessly replaced other parts first. Is Your Trailblazer’s Transmission Acting Up?
A failing TCM can manifest in several ways. If you’re experiencing any of the following, it’s a strong indicator that your module needs replacement:
- ✔ Abrupt, jerky, or delayed gear shifts that disrupt your drive.
- ✔ The vehicle enters “limp mode,” often getting stuck in 2nd or 3rd gear.
- ✔ The Check Engine Light or a dedicated transmission warning light is illuminated.
- ✔ Your scan tool shows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s) like P0700, P0750, P0753, P0758, or other solenoid-related faults.
- ✔ A sudden and unexplained drop in fuel economy.
- ✔ Complete failure to shift, leaving you stranded.
Your 30-Minute Path to a Smooth Ride
One of the best features of this module is its simple, DIY-friendly installation. You don’t need a lift or specialized transmission tools. For the 2006-2009 Trailblazer TCM, the process is straightforward:
- Safety First: Always disconnect the negative terminal from your vehicle’s battery before starting any electrical work.
- Locate the TCM: On the Trailblazer, the TCM is typically found in the engine compartment on the driver’s side (LH side).
- Disconnect and Remove: Carefully unplug the electrical connectors. Use a socket wrench to remove the bolts holding the old module in place.
- Install the New Module: Mount your new, pre-programmed TCM and securely fasten the bolts. Reconnect the electrical harnesses until they click.
- Final Steps: Reconnect the battery terminal. While our programming handles the critical setup, it’s good practice to use a basic OBD-II scan tool to clear any stored fault codes from the ECU. Start the vehicle and enjoy restored, smooth shifting!
